Ingredients

Scale
  • 2 cups finely diced apple
  • 2 cups flour (spelt, white, or oat)
  • 3/4 cup sugar
  • 1 cup milk (of choice)
  • 3 1/2 tbsp oil (or applesauce)
  • 2 tsp baking powder
  • 1/2 tsp baking soda
  • 1/2 tsp cinnamon
  • 3/4 tsp salt
  • 2 tsp pure vanilla extract

Instructions

  1.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C).
  2. In a mixing bowl, combine flour, baking powder, salt, baking soda, cinnamon, and sugar.
  3. In another bowl, mix diced apples, milk, oil (or applesauce), and vanilla extract until combined.
  4. Gradually add the wet mixture to the dry ingredients and stir until just combined—avoid overmixing.
  5. Pour the batter into a greased 9×5 loaf pan and bake for about 50 minutes.
  6. Check for doneness with a toothpick; it should come out mostly clean.
  7. Let cool in the pan briefly before transferring to a wire rack. Cover overnight for optimal flavor before slicing.
